TWO QINGBAI DISHES AND TWO BOWLS
SOUTHERN SONG-YUAN DYNASTY, 12TH-14TH CENTURY
The first bowl is carved with lotus blossoms beneath a key-fret border. The second bowl is carved with abstract floral scroll with brushed details. The third is a dish carved in the center with a single lotus blossom beneath the scalloped rim. The last is a shallow dish carved with a single blossom in the center and with abstract scroll in the cavetto.
5 ½, 6 ¾, 5 ½, 4 in., (14, 17, 14, 10.2 cm.) diam.
